The EU is still far behind the US in terms of competitiveness, according to a new report published today.
The survey, conducted by the World Economic Forum, measures the competitiveness of countries based on eight criteria, including promoting innovation and an enterprise culture.
Based on these measures, the US scores an average of 5.55 out of 7, compared to 4.97 out of 7 for the EU.
